Monitoring tools
Your account gives you direct access to up-to-date information about companies you've invested in – just click on the investment name to view the comprehensive data sheet, with financial analysis, news, and, where available, a round-up of brokers' views.
You’ll also have access to ‘limit’ orders, ‘stop’ orders and alert facilities to keep you advised or take action when a share hits your price point; our free Annual Reports service to obtain copies of reports from companies in which you have invested or are thinking of investing in, and an ‘at-a-glance view of how your investments are doing.
